Dingle La Le Bride Single Malt - Wheel of the Year Series
Special features: Part of the exclusive Wheel of the Year Series from Dingle, characterized by a combination of aging in bourbon casks with a finish in rye casks. The limited release comes unchill-filtered and without the addition of coloring in an elegant gift box.
Tasting Notes:
Nose: Fresh notes of vanilla and honey, accompanied by spicy accents of rye.
Palate: Robust with a balanced sweetness, marked by toasted wood and subtle fruitiness.
Finish: Long-lasting with peppery and slightly nutty nuances.
Distillery/Bottler: The Dingle Whiskey Distillery in Ireland is known for its artisanal production of single malts. Founded in the 2010s, it combines traditional methods with innovative aging techniques and emphasizes the use of regional ingredients.
